Explosion Proof Equipment Market : Global Industry Analysis and Forecast (2025-2032)

Global Explosion Proof Equipment Market size was valued at USD 9.20 Bn. in 2024 and the total Global Explosion Proof Equipment Market revenue is expected to grow at a CAGR of 5.6% from 2025 to 2032, reaching nearly USD 14.23 Bn. by 2032.

Global Explosion Proof Equipment Market Overview

Explosion proof equipment refers to devices and systems designed to prevent explosions and fires in potentially explosive atmospheres where there are flammable gases, vapours, dust or fibres. Explosion Proof Equipment Market has been growing by increasing demand from oil & gas operators, chemical processors, mining contractors and manufacturing industries. Rising focus on worker safety, equipment reliability in hazardous environments and compliance with global safety standards is accelerating market adoption. Expanding application of explosion proof equipment across petrochemical plants, refineries, marine vessels, grain handling facilities and pharmaceutical production is reshaping traditional safety protocols and supporting rise of robust, intrinsically safe industrial systems. Technological advancements like flameproof enclosure designs, intrinsic safety barriers, smart sensor integration and AI assisted hazard detection are enhancing efficiency, durability and real time responsiveness of explosion proof equipment production and utilization. Market is supported by increasingly stringent regulatory frameworks, growing emphasis on workplace risk mitigation, rising demand for smart and connected safety devices and global shift toward sustainable and automated industrial infrastructure. North America dominated the Explosion Proof Equipment Market, driven by region’s stringent industrial safety mandates, robust oil & gas and chemical sectors, early adoption of advanced safety technologies and high investments in infrastructure modernization and automation. Based on the Zone, the global Explosion Proof Equipment market is segmented into Zone 0, Zone 1, Zone 2, Zone 12, Zone 20, Zone 21, and Zone 22. The Zone 0 segment is expected to grow at the highest CAGR of 5.9% during the forecast period. An explosive environment consisting of air and combustible substances in the form of gas, vapour, or mist is maintained in this zone constantly, for a long period of time, or on a regular basis. During the forecast period, the Zone 1 section is expected to grow steadily. This zone contains an explosive environment made up of a mixture of air and hazardous materials in the form of gas, vapour, or mist that can develop during daily routines. Based on the End-Use, the global Explosion Proof Equipment market is segmented into Mining, Chemicals & Pharmaceutical, Energy & Power, Oil & Gas, and Others. The Oil & Gas segment is expected to grow at the highest CAGR of 5.7% during the forecast period. To minimize explosions, explosion-proof equipment is widely employed in refineries, drilling operations, and the repair of cable hoists for LNG plants. Oil and gas production plants are hazardous because hazardous substances are present throughout the operations. Explosion-proof equipment systems are fitted to avoid the ignition of sparks from electrical equipment. As moreover, the presence of toxic chemicals in oil and gas activities presents additional safety challenges for the personnel.

Global Explosion Proof Equipment Market Trends

• Smart Explosion Proof Devices & IIoT Integration Growing adoption of smart sensors, real-time monitoring, and remote diagnostics in explosion proof equipment and Integration with Industrial Internet of Things (IIoT) platforms for predictive maintenance and data analytics. • Miniaturization & Modular Designs Development of compact, lightweight and modular explosion proof components suitable for confined industrial environments. • Rising Demand for Wireless Explosion Proof Communication Systems Increasing use of wireless transmitters, mobile communication devices, and networking systems with explosion-proof certification. Global Explosion Proof Equipment Market Recent Development • On March 8, 2025, Eaton Corporation (USA) Showcased a full suite of explosion-proof and intrinsically safe solutions at Automation Expo South 2025 in Chennai, India including Crouse-Hinds lighting, MTL Zone Guardian, and EPIK explosion protected PTZ cameras. Also signed an MoU to expand local operations in Tamil Nadu. • In June 2024, Fuji Electric Co., Ltd. (Japan) Launched the EXV1000-7W 10 HP explosion-proof blower, UL-certified for Class I Div. 1 applications, designed for use in hazardous ventilation environments. • In June 2024, Honeywell International Inc. (USA) Completed the acquisition of Enraf Holding B.V., expanding its explosion-proof precision metering systems portfolio for the oil & gas industry. • In March 2024, Emerson Electric Co. (USA) Launched the Rosemount SAM42 Acoustic Particle Monitor, a non-intrusive explosion-proof sensor for measuring entrained sand in oil & gas wells, enabling real time erosion risk monitoring.
